Slope Run


Slope Run continuously throws out space gaps and trap floors that distract the player as they control the ball rolling on the endless space tunnel.

Terrain Challenges in Slope Run

  • The slope is randomly generated with many different shapes. This eliminates the ability to memorize and forces the player to react immediately to the new terrain.
  • Along the slope, there are always large gaps or gaps that force the ball to jump over or dodge. If you do not move accurately, the ball will fall down.
  • You can change the color of the ball when rolling through the colored boxes with two rotating arrows to change color.
  • Coins will appear on the way for you to collect. These coins are always in the yellow box, so you can easily recognize them.

Tips for Playing Slope Run to Conquer Speed

  • If you observe far away, you can recognize the obstacles right in front of you. Scan your vision further to be able to recognize the shape of the next slope (narrow road, gap, red block) and plan your move early.
  • Move quickly and boldly to go as far as possible. Controlling the ball is quite easy, you just need to master moving left and right to become a master of avoiding obstacles in the game. Use space to jump over deep holes.
  • As the speed increases, switching from one side of the slope to the other (e.g., from the left edge to the right edge) needs to be done in a quick sequence of actions: move a little into the center of the slope, then move sharply to the other edge. Avoid going diagonally too far.
